1. ATO CAREER PLANNING TOOL (CPT) RATER GUIDE

What is the CPT?

The ATO Career Planning Tool (CPT) offers activities and resources that FAA employees can use to plan their career within the ATO. The CPT helps employees to:

• Explore their career options within ATO

• Prepare for targeted positions through job-specific development suggestions

• Identify your strengths and areas for improvement through job-specific assessment and development tools

• Solicit feedback and ratings from their managers and colleagues on their knowledge, skills, and abilities

• Build customized Career Paths and Career Plans.

What is the Focus of the Rater Guide?

This guide covers the procedures for using the CPT to provide ratings of an employee or a colleague who requested them from you. The primary sections in the guide include:

• Getting Started

• Rating.

This guide is intended for FAA employees who receive a request to evaluate an employee’s or colleague’s current knowledge and skills with respect to a position of interest to them.

5 The bottom part of the Rate a Colleague page lists the knowledge areas on which you will rate your colleague. These are the knowledge areas needed for the target position listed at the top of the page.

For each Knowledge listed on the page, select one of the three scale points by clicking the radio button displayed beneath the scale point.

• Development Need (Red): This knowledge or skill should be strengthened to meet the demands of the target position.

• Proficient (Yellow): This is a knowledge or skill in which the person has achieved competence needed for the target job, but could still be improved. Development in this area may not be a high priority.

• Strength (Green): This is a strong asset that can be applied to the target position. Strength in this knowledge or skill may exceed standards and is not a developmental priority.

You can clear your selections by clicking the Clear button at the top right of the rating scale. You can write notes and comments to your colleague in the text field at the bottom of the page.
